Subject: [GIT PULL] HID fixes

Linus,

please pull from

  git://git.kernel.org/pub/scm/linux/kernel/git/hid/hid.git tags/for-linus-2023101101

to get HID subsystem fixes for 6.6.

=====
- regression fix for i2c-hid when used on DT platforms (Johan Hovold)
- kernel crash fix on removal of the Logitech USB receiver (Hans de Goede)
